Scottrade Taps Osborne to Lead IT Security


WEBWIRE

IT department experiences staggering growth, seeks more than 157 professionals

DENVER AND ST. LOUIS – Chad Osborne was recently promoted to director of information technology (IT) communications and security for online investing firm Scottrade. He will oversee six departments with the core responsibility of ensuring customers can securely and reliably contact the firm via the Internet or telephone.

Osborne joined St. Louis-based Scottrade in 2009 as manager of security operations. Most recently he served as assistant director of IT communications and security.

“Security is ingrained in every aspect of Scottrade’s business,” Osborne said. “For more than 30 years, Scottrade has been a trusted resource for self-directed investors. As the firm continues to grow, we will continue to monitor and maintain the highest levels of information reliability and security.”

Within his new role, Osborne oversees the firm’s websites and data security. Scottrade has multiple online trading tools, including the Scottrade® Trading Website, Scottrader® Streaming Quotes, ScottradeELITE® and Scottrade OptionsFirst®.

“Scottrade has afforded incredible opportunities to work with exceptional associates who truly care about the service they provide to internal and external customers,” said Joan Albeck, chief technology officer. “The growth Scottrade has experienced, affords associates career advancement in a variety of areas.”

Scottrade has more than 157 open positions within its IT department, including 114 at its St. Louis headquarters and 38 at its secondary business operations center in Westminster, Colo. Interested candidates can find Scottrade employment opportunities and apply online at careers.scottrade.com.
